Like the title says, I'm on the hunt for the parts I need to do the '05 efans conversion into my '02 Silverado ECSB. I need the following:
34" Radiator (prefer OEM but will accept Rad Barn version)
'05 efans (OEM only as I've not heard good things about clones)
145 Amp Alternator (needs to be compatible w/ '02 truck!)
Harness (Blackbear or Nelson, heard they are both excellent!)

I have the whole kit minus the alternator for 400 shipped
OEM 34" Rad with tranny cooler
OEM 05+ fans
Nelson harness that I modified for 2 pin operation.
With this setup, I didn't need the 145 amp alt and had no noticeable dimming issues. Its on the truck right now, but wouldn't take long to take off if I had a buyer....
